Union Educational Complex, a moderately sized combined-grade school in Mount Storm, West Virginia, part of Grant County Schools, educates 188 students, covering grades pre-K through 12.
Grant County Schools comprises 4 schools with combined enrollment of 1,617 students; Union Educational Complex is among them.
In terms of who attends, Union Educational Complex shows that nearly all students (97%) are White. Compared to Grant County overall, the school's racial mix sits in roughly the same range.
On the income-and-resources front, Staff filings list 16 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 11.7:1 students per teacher. Statewide, the average ratio sits near 12.9:1, putting Union Educational Complex tighter than the state norm the norm.
Across the wider county, the surrounding county (Grant County) shows that median household income runs about $62,361, about 14%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 7%. Union Educational Complex is one of 5 public schools in Grant County (combined enrollment of about 1,617 students).
Swan Meadow School is the nearest neighboring public school, about 9.7 miles from this campus.
Geographically, the school is in a small-town area.
Over the past 7-year window. Union Educational Complex's enrollment has contracted 5% since 2018, when it stood at 197 (now 188).
